Job Summary:  The Paramedic responds to emergency calls. Performs medical services and transporting patients to medical facilities. Cares for sick or injured in emergency medical settings.

Additional Department Summary:  Responsible for rendering initial evaluations of patients and directing advanced life support and/or critical care procedures for sick and injured persons. Provides out of hospital emergency medical care and transportation for critical and emergent patients, including non-emergency/routine medical transports and life threatening emergencies. Performs interventions with the basic and advanced equipment typically found on an ambulance. Leads stabilization and safe transport of patients needing emergency care. Functions as part of a comprehensive EMS response system, under medical oversight, and serves as a link from the scene to the emergency health care system. Completes incident reports in a timely and accurate manner.

Required Minimum Qualifications:  High School Diploma or GED required. Must be licensed as an Paramedic by the State of Alabama.

Additional Required Department Minimum Qualifications: Current Basic Life Support (BLS), Advanced Cardiovascular Life Support (ACLS), Pediatric Advanced Life Support (PALS) and CPR/AED First Aid certification, or ability to obtain upon hire.

Must be able to lift/push up to 200 pounds; this position will assist in the evacuation of sick and injured persons during an emergency.

Must have valid U.S. driver's license. Must be at least 19 years of age at time of hire and have an acceptable Motor Vehicle Report that is in compliance with University policies. Applicants under the age of 21 will have some driving restrictions.

Final candidates who are not current University of Alabama employees must submit to and successfully pass a post-offer drug screen.

Skills and Knowledge:  Working knowledge of the physical layout, street systems, and demographics of the University of Alabama campus and surrounding area. Functional understanding of basic equipment typically found on an ambulance. Functional understanding of communications equipment, including telephone, 2-way radios, and recording equipment.

Excellent clinical, organizational, and administrative skills. Ability to communicate effectively with staff and health care professionals. Ability to maintain strict confidentiality of protected health information and the requirement to follow HIPPA regulations at all times.

Ability to cope with stressful conditions. Ability to demonstrate tact, versatility, and adaptability. Ability to demonstrate a high degree of self-motivation and directional initiative. Working knowledge of data entry and Microsoft Office. Skill in exercising initiative, judgment, problem-solving, and decision-making.
